Mastering Cake Merge 2 Controls

You control the placement of every slice. The goal is to match identical pieces to merge them. You place pieces strategically to ensure you have room for new arrivals. The game rewards precision. You must track which pieces are coming next. This requires focus and a steady hand. You interact with a grid that demands constant attention. If you place a slice in the wrong spot, you risk a game over. You must balance the need for speed with the need for accuracy. The controls are intuitive and responsive. You spend your time arranging cakes to create the perfect flow.

  • Click a cake slice to select it.
  • Drag the piece to an empty spot on the tray.
  • Drop the slice next to a matching piece to merge.
  • Clear the board by completing full cakes.

Winning Strategies for zistop Fans

Space is your biggest enemy in this singleplayer experience. You need to plan where each piece lands. Don't let your tray fill up. Group similar cakes together to trigger chain reactions. These combos clear multiple spots at once. Keep your center open for flexible moves. You win by thinking three steps ahead. High-level play involves managing your cake types. You avoid filling the corners too early. You prioritize the largest cakes first to maximize space. This tactical approach helps you survive the smarter challenges found in Cake Merge 2. You learn the patterns of the cake spawns. You optimize your layout for maximum efficiency. zistop players often find that a clean board is the only way to reach the top scores. You focus on building clusters. You create zones for specific colors. This organization prevents chaos. You manage the board like a professional baker. You anticipate the next move before the piece even appears. This foresight separates the beginners from the experts. You must also consider the sequence of merges. A single merge can trigger another, and that one can trigger another. You call this a chain reaction. You spend time setting up these cascades. You place pieces in a way that one merge collapses a whole section of the board. This is the most efficient way to play. You minimize the number of moves you make. You maximize the amount of space you regain. This strategic depth makes the game more than a simple puzzle. It becomes a test of your spatial awareness.
